"""Async load test for the TraceRAG FastAPI endpoint. Start the API first (uvicorn api:app --port 8000), then: python scripts/stress_test.py --requests 200 --concurrency 25 """ from __future__ import annotations import argparse import asyncio import time from collections import Counter import aiohttp QUERIES = [ "What was incident INC-4471 about?", "What is the responsibility of the PaymentService?", "Who is the tech lead and owning team for PaymentService?", "What does payment-service depend on?", "How does the AuthLayer handle login and JWT issuance?", "Explain the ShopFlow commerce platform architecture.", "What is related to PR #847?", "Which component was affected in incident INC-4480?", ] async def _one(session, url, query, sem, timeout) -> dict: async with sem: start = time.perf_counter() try: async with session.post(url, json={"query": query}, timeout=timeout) as resp: await resp.read() # drain return {"status": resp.status, "latency": time.perf_counter() - start} except asyncio.TimeoutError: return {"status": "timeout", "latency": time.perf_counter() - start} except aiohttp.ClientError as exc: return {"status": f"error:{type(exc).__name__}", "latency": time.perf_counter() - start} async def run(url: str, total: int, concurrency: int, timeout: float) -> None: sem = asyncio.Semaphore(concurrency) print(f"Hammering {url}\n {total} requests, concurrency={concurrency}, " f"timeout={timeout}s\n") wall_start = time.perf_counter() async with aiohttp.ClientSession() as session: tasks = [ _one(session, url, QUERIES[i % len(QUERIES)], sem, timeout) for i in range(total) ] results = await asyncio.gather(*tasks) wall = time.perf_counter() - wall_start statuses = Counter(r["status"] for r in results) ok = [r["latency"] for r in results if r["status"] == 200] lat = sorted(r["latency"] for r in results) def pct(p: float) -> float: return lat[min(len(lat) - 1, int(len(lat) * p))] if lat else 0.0 print("=" * 60) print(f"{'Status / outcome':<28}{'count':>10}") print("-" * 60) for status, n in sorted(statuses.items(), key=lambda kv: str(kv[0])): print(f"{str(status):<28}{n:>10}") print("-" * 60) print(f"wall time {wall:>8.2f}s") print(f"throughput {total / wall:>8.1f} req/s") print(f"success (200) {len(ok):>8} / {total}") print(f"latency p50/p90/p99 {pct(.5):.3f} / {pct(.9):.3f} / {pct(.99):.3f} s") print(f"latency max {(lat[-1] if lat else 0):.3f} s") print("=" * 60) if any(str(s).startswith(("error", "timeout")) or s in (500, 502) for s in statuses): print("\n[!] Hard failures present (5xx/timeout/conn-error): the worker may " "not be degrading gracefully — check for crashes or DB read-locks.") if statuses.get(429) or statuses.get(503): print("\n[ok] Server shed load with 429/503 under pressure (graceful).") def main(argv: list[str] | None = None) -> int: p = argparse.ArgumentParser(description="TraceRAG async load test.") p.add_argument("--url", default="http://127.0.0.1:8000/api/trace") p.add_argument("--requests", type=int, default=100) p.add_argument("--concurrency", type=int, default=20) p.add_argument("--timeout", type=float, default=30.0) args = p.parse_args(argv) asyncio.run(run(args.url, args.requests, args.concurrency, args.timeout)) return 0 if __name__ == "__main__": raise SystemExit(main())
